Function: vip-forward-Word
vip-forward-Word is an interactive and byte-compiled function defined
in vip.el.gz.
Signature
(vip-forward-Word ARG)
Documentation
Forward word delimited by white character.
Key Bindings
Source Code
;; Defined in /usr/src/emacs/lisp/obsolete/vip.el.gz
(defun vip-forward-Word (arg)
"Forward word delimited by white character."
(interactive "P")
(let ((val (vip-p-val arg))
(com (vip-getcom arg)))
(if com (move-marker vip-com-point (point)))
(re-search-forward "[^ \t\n]*[ \t\n]+" nil t val)
(if com
(progn
(if (or (= com ?c) (= com (- ?c)))
(progn (backward-word 1) (forward-word 1)))
(if (or (= com ?d) (= com ?y))
(progn
(backward-word 1)
(forward-word 1)
(skip-chars-forward " \t")))
(vip-execute-com 'vip-forward-Word val com)))))